Additive manufacturing
Additive manufacturing involves the manufacture of a three-dimensional prototype or product layer by layer. This new technology enables flexible new ways of solving problems, manufacturing innovative components and making parts.
The benefits of additive manufacturing include unique customisation, easily applying changes to production and performing quick, inexpensive testing during construction of prototypes (no special tools are required). Additive manufacturing makes it possible to produce new, complex designs and reduce stages of production, which often contributes to shorter lead times, better product characteristics, less waste and lower costs.
One of the basic concepts within flexible manufacturing is 3D printing, whereby a printer generates three dimensional objects.
